Software Engineer, II - Scaled Simulation
Job description
About the role
Torc Robotics is seeking a talented Software Engineer II to join our Scaled Simulation team. This position involves designing, developing, and maintaining cloud-based simulation services that support testing and validation of autonomous vehicle systems. You will work closely with cross-functional teams to enhance our simulation infrastructure, improve system reliability, and ensure seamless integration with vehicle testing workflows. The role offers an exciting opportunity to contribute to cutting-edge autonomous vehicle technology by building scalable, robust, and efficient simulation solutions in a cloud environment. The ideal candidate will have a strong background in software engineering, cloud systems, and automation, with a passion for robotics and simulation.
Key facts
This position is based on-site at either our Ann Arbor, Michigan office or our Blacksburg, Virginia office. It is a full-time role, requiring on-site presence as specified. The team you will join is focused on simulation environments, working to develop and operate large-scale cloud simulation services that support our autonomous vehicle testing efforts. The role involves collaboration with other engineering teams, including vehicle software, perception, and control teams, to ensure simulation systems meet the needs of vehicle testing and development. What you'll do
- Design, develop, and oversee cloud-based simulation services that facilitate virtual testing of autonomous vehicle systems, including large-scale simulation runs and driver-stack validation.
- Write, test, and maintain high-quality code primarily in Python and C++, ensuring robustness and efficiency in simulation software components.
- Deploy and manage scalable cloud infrastructure using AWS services, including EC2, S3, Lambda, and others, to support simulation workloads.
- Implement infrastructure-as-code solutions using Terraform to automate provisioning, configuration, and management of cloud resources, ensuring repeatability and reliability.
- Collaborate with hardware and software teams to integrate simulation services with vehicle testing workflows, providing support and troubleshooting as needed.
- Develop automation pipelines for continuous integration and continuous deployment (CI/CD), enabling rapid iteration and deployment of simulation updates.
- Create and maintain comprehensive documentation for simulation systems, APIs, and workflows to facilitate team collaboration and onboarding.
- Support vehicle testing activities by providing simulation data, troubleshooting issues, and optimizing simulation performance.

Requirements
- Bachelor's degree in Computer Science, Robotics, Electrical Engineering, or a related field, with a minimum of 5 years of relevant experience; or a Master's degree with at least 3 years of experience.
- Proven experience designing and deploying managed cloud services, preferably with AWS cloud platform.
- Strong programming skills in Python and C++, with a solid understanding of software engineering principles and best practices.
- Hands-on experience working in Linux environments, including scripting with Bash and other shell languages.
- Familiarity with infrastructure-as-code tools such as Terraform for provisioning and managing cloud infrastructure.
- Knowledge of modern software development workflows, including CI/CD pipelines, automated testing, and version control systems like Git.
- Excellent analytical, troubleshooting, and problem-solving skills, with the ability to work independently and as part of a team.
- Strong communication skills, capable of documenting complex systems and collaborating effectively across teams.
Nice to have
- Experience working with autonomous vehicle systems, robotics, or simulation environments.
- Production experience with C++ in a software engineering context.
- Familiarity with Bazel build system and build automation tools.
- Knowledge of Robot Operating System (ROS) and related robotics middleware.
- Understanding of robotics algorithms, sensor data processing, and vehicle control systems.
- Experience with containerization technologies such as Docker or Kubernetes.
- Exposure to simulation frameworks and tools used in autonomous vehicle development.
